Market performance shows brand's share of foot traffic, revealing competitive strength and customer preference in the industry.
Dros holds a leading market performance position in South Africa's Cafe & Restaurants industry with a percentile of 99. This indicates a strong market presence. Performance peers include Dunes Beach Restaurant & Bar, Barcelos, Quay Four Restaurant, kung-fu kitchen, Parrots and Hogshead, all within a similar top-tier position.
Customer satisfaction is critical for brand loyalty and repeat business, reflecting service quality and customer experience.
Dros' overall customer satisfaction is 44%, a decrease of 21.5 percentage points year-over-year. Western Cape shows 58% satisfaction, while Gauteng is at 38%. The trend shows a decline in CSAT from April to June 2025, indicating a need for service improvements.
Average check reveals customer spending habits, influencing revenue and profitability strategies.
The overall average check for Dros is 303.2 ZAR, a 0.9% increase year-over-year. Western Cape has an average check of 347.2 ZAR, while Gauteng's average check is 294.8 ZAR. Average check fluctuated between April and June 2025, indicating a need to analyze pricing strategies.
Outlet count indicates brand reach and market presence, affecting accessibility and brand recognition.
Dros has 9 outlets in Gauteng, and 1 outlet each in Mpumalanga, Limpopo, KwaZulu-Natal, Northern Cape, and Western Cape. Gauteng represents a significant portion of Dros' outlet footprint. Evaluate outlet distribution to optimize market coverage.
Understanding competitors helps refine strategies to capture market share and enhance competitive edge.
The top competitors for Dros, based on customer cross-visitation, are KFC (17.20%), McDonald's (15.05%), Spur (13.98%), Burger King (7.53%), and RocoMamas (6.45%). These brands attract a portion of Dros' customer base.
Traffic workload indicates peak hours, enabling optimal staffing and resource allocation for customer service.
Dros experiences peak traffic workload between 16:00 and 18:00, reaching a maximum at 18:00. Traffic gradually increases from 8:00 to 18:00, then declines through the night. Staffing and resource planning should align with these peak hours.
